What is An Industrial Safety?

Industrial safety refers to the management of all operations and events within an industry to protect employees, assets, and the environment by minimizing hazards, risks, and accidents. This involves implementing various safety measures, systems, and procedures to ensure a safe and healthy working environment. Industrial safety covers various aspects such as:

  • General Safety: Includes workplace safety policies, safe work practices, and employee training to create a safe working environment.
  • Machine Safety: Ensures that machines are properly designed, maintained, and operated to prevent accidents and protect operators from harm.
  • Fire Safety: Involves the implementation of fire prevention measures, firefighting equipment, and emergency evacuation plans to protect employees and assets from fire hazards.
  • Health Safety: Covers the prevention of occupational illnesses and diseases by implementing proper hygiene practices, personal protective equipment (PPE), and health monitoring programs.
  • Environmental Safety: Focuses on minimizing the environmental impact of industrial operations by managing waste, emissions, and resource consumption.
  • Electrical Safety: Ensures the safe design, installation, and maintenance of electrical systems to prevent electrical hazards and accidents.
  • Building Safety: Involves the proper design, construction, and maintenance of buildings and structures to ensure their structural integrity and safety.
  • Material Safety: Covers the safe handling, storage, and disposal of hazardous materials, as well as the proper use of material safety data sheets (MSDS) and labeling.

Industrial safety is a crucial aspect of management and requires the collaboration of safety professionals, management, and employees to effectively minimize risks and maintain a safe working environment. The primary responsibility of safety professionals is to keep employees and the company safe from accidents and hazards by implementing appropriate safety measures and continuously monitoring and improving safety performance.

Why Machine Safety is So Important?

Industrial machines can be extremely dangerous, leading to a range of injuries, such as:

  • Crushed limbs, hands, or fingers from pressing actions
  • Cuts and wounds from sharp edges
  • Limbs getting trapped in moving parts like belts and rollers
  • Broken bones

Due to the potential risks, industry experts recommend prioritizing safety at different stages of the machine lifecycle, including design, manufacture, installation, adjustment, operation, and maintenance.

Why is Machine Safety is So Important?

Since December 29th, 2009, the Machinery Directive 2006/42/EC of the European Parliament and the Council requires machine manufacturers to adhere to a minimum set of safety requirements. This directive ensures that safety is an integral part of machine development and usage.

In simple, machine safety is crucial to protect operators and employees from injuries and accidents while working with industrial machines. By incorporating safety measures and adhering to safety regulations, industries can create a safe working environment and minimize the risks associated with machine operations.

What is the Risk Assessment?

Risk assessment is a systematic process of identifying hazards, estimating risks, evaluating risks, and reducing risks within a workplace.

It is important to understand the difference between hazards and risks:

  • A hazard is anything that can cause harm, including work accidents, emergency situations, toxic chemicals, employee conflicts, and stress.
  • A risk, on the other hand, is the chance that a hazard will cause harm.

As part of your risk assessment plan, you will identify hazards and then calculate the risk or likelihood of the hazards occurring.

5 Steps to Risk Assessment:

The goal of a risk assessment plan or process will vary industry-wise, but the goal is to help organizations prepare for and combat risk.

5 Steps to Risk Assessment

Step 1:  Identify the Hazards (Risk Identification)

The first step in creating your risk assessment plan is determining the hazards your employees and your company face. Take a look around your workplace and observe processes or activities that could potentially harm your organization.

Review accident/incident reports to determine past hazards and consult with senior and junior-level team members in your organization.

Step 2:  Decide who may be harmed and how (Risk Analysis)

Consider how your employees could be harmed by business activities or external factors for every hazard identified in step one. Determine who will be affected should the hazard occur.

Step 3:  Evaluate the risks and decide on control measures (Risk Evaluation)

Assess the likelihood and severity of each hazard’s consequences. This evaluation will help you prioritize which hazards to address first and determine the level of risk reduction needed.

Safety component manufacturers’ technical engineers can offer guidance on solutions and safety components to eliminate specific risks.

Step 4:  Record your Hazards findings and Solutions.

Document all data regarding the hazards and how you reduced those issues, regardless of your company’s size. Your plan should include the identified hazards, who is affected, and how you plan to eliminate the issue.

Step 5: Review the assessment and update it if necessary

Workplace activities, equipment, and personnel are always changing, leading to new risks and hazards. Continually review and update your risk assessment process to stay on top of these new hazards and ensure that your safety measures remain effective.

What Are The Important Machine Safety Products?

As previously discussed, machine safety is focused on protecting humans from machinery hazards. Various safety products can be integrated into machinery to help ensure the safety of your employees. Let’s have a look at some of the essential machine safety products.

Safety Light Curtain:

A safety light curtain is an optoelectronic device that detects the presence of objects within certain areas and initiates an emergency shutdown of hazardous machinery when such detection occurs. They are designed to prevent injuries to workers who may inadvertently get too close to the machines.

Emergency Stop Buttons:

Emergency stop buttons, also known as Emergency Safety Switches, are safety mechanisms used to shut down machinery in emergency situations when manual shutdown is not possible or too dangerous. Emergency Safety Push Buttons are designed to protect both the operator and the machine in various emergency scenarios.

Emergency stop switches are wired in series with the control circuit of the machine. When the emergency stop switch is pressed, it breaks the circuit and removes the power supply to the machine, causing it to stop operation immediately. This swift response can prevent accidents, minimize damage, and protect the operator and the surrounding environment from potential harm.

Safety Scanner:

Safety scanners, also known as safety laser scanners, are photoelectric barriers with rotating lasers that can be programmed to guard irregularly shaped areas. When an object is detected in the hazard zone, a stop signal is initiated, and a warning alert is sent to personnel when they are approaching the protected area. The machinery will automatically stop when a person comes too close to the hazard zone.

One of the significant advantages of using safety scanners is their flexibility in providing protection for large and/or irregularly shaped areas. If you relocate an application or modify a machine, it is easy to adjust the scanner’s safeguard area to fit the new application. This adaptability makes safety scanners a valuable asset in maintaining a safe working environment within various industrial settings.

Safety Scanners
Safety Mat Omron, Leuze

Safety Mat:

Safety mats, also known as safety floor mats, are pressure-sensitive electric switches designed to detect the presence of feet or vehicles. They are ideal for risk reduction strategies that require preventing machine startups or initiating machine shutdowns when someone enters a hazardous area.

In addition to their functional role in safety, safety mats also provide a clear visual reminder to humans, helping them identify the safeguarded area. This can further contribute to maintaining a safe working environment by increasing awareness of potentially hazardous zones within the workplace.

Safety Door Switch or Interlock Switch:

Safety Door Switches, also known as Interlock Switches, are used to prevent or permit access to hazardous machinery or workplaces that have been protected by guarding or safety doors. These switches are designed to activate or cut off the electrical current in specific situations and lock the barrier in place.

When the safety door or guarding is opened, the current will be switched off, ensuring that the machinery cannot operate while the safety barrier is compromised. This helps to maintain a safe working environment by preventing accidental operation of machinery during maintenance or inspection, reducing the risk of injuries and accidents.

Safety Door Switch & Interlock Switch Leuze Omron
Safety Relay Leuze Omron

Safety Relay:

Safety relays are monitoring devices designed to detect electrical and mechanical faults in machinery. Once a problem is detected, relays can initiate various responses to protect workers or prevent expensive breakdowns. These responses may include pausing the machinery, initiating an emergency stop, or shutting down the electrical current.

Safety relays typically work in conjunction with other protective equipment, such as light barriers and safety mats. By integrating these devices into a comprehensive safety system, it is possible to create a safer working environment that minimizes the risk of accidents and injuries while maintaining the efficient operation of industrial machinery.

Rope Pull Switch:

Rope pull switches provide an emergency stop function initiated by pulling on a wire or rope. They are typically used in situations where a conventional emergency stop button would be awkward to access or inaccessible, such as in conveyor applications.

These switches allow operators to quickly and easily stop machinery from a distance, increasing safety and reducing the risk of accidents. By incorporating rope pull switches alongside other safety components, a comprehensive safety system can be created to protect both workers and machinery in various industrial settings.

Safety Pull Rope Switch Leuze, Omron

Machine safety is a critical aspect of maintaining a safe and efficient work environment. By understanding and implementing various safety components, such as safety light curtains, emergency stop buttons, safety scanners, safety mats, safety door switches, safety relays, and rope pull switches, organizations can significantly reduce the risk of accidents and injuries while maximizing productivity.

What is a Safety Light Curtain?

A safety light curtain is a device that detects the presence of objects within certain areas and initiates an emergency shutdown of hazardous machinery when such detection occurs.

In the past, industries primarily used machine safeguarding, such as mechanical barriers, sliding gates, and pull-back restraints, to protect operators around many hazardous machines. However, safety light curtains offer flexibility, freedom, and reduced operator fatigue compared to traditional safeguarding methods.

How Does a Safety Light Curtain Work?

Mainly  Safety Light Curtain consists of TWO parts that are Transmitter & Receiver. (Same as Through Beam Photoelectric Sensors)

Safety Light Curtain Transmitter Consists of several Light Emitting Diodes (LED) it will emit Infrared lights to the receiver. With a specific frequency, it will emit Infrared Signals. And the Other side the Safety Light Curtain Receiver Receives  Infrared signals with a specific frequency.

When an object passes through Emitter and Receiver, That object interrupts the receiver signal. 

(In Simple, a continuous emitter will send a signal to the receiver, then everything fine machine will work continuously. Suppose If I interrupt signals, or In-between Emitter and receiver signal I inserted my hand, so through my hand infrared won’t reach to Receiver. so the receiver is not getting signals. Then immediately Receiver will send a signal to the controller to stop the machine immediately. )

Varieties of Safety Light Curtains:

There are TWO Types of Varieties there. Those are Point of Operation Control (POC) Safety Light Curtain and Perimeter Access Control (PAC) Safety Light Curtains.

Point of Operation Control (POC) Safety Light Curtains: These POC Safety Light Curtains are designed to protect on a small scale. To protect hands, fingers, and arms. These POC Safety Light Curtains are generally located very close to the machine, directly where the operator will be interacting with machines.

When Finger, Hand, Arm detects a dangerous location in or around the machine at the wrong time, POC Safety Light Curtain will send a signal to the Machine controller to shut down to prevent injury.

Point of Operation Control (POC) Safety Light Curtains

Perimeter Access Control (PAC) Safety Light Curtains: These PAC Safety Light Curtains are designed to protect the full body. PAC Safety Light Curtains essentially create like a fence around machines that don’t require close usage by the machine operators and are designed to detect people or objects when they enter into the light barrier.

In simple terms, PAC Safety Light Curtains, Operators are not going to contact the machines directly, but they will reach very near to the Machine.

Perimeter Access Control (PAC) Safety Light Curtains

Both Point of Operation Control (POC) Safety Light Curtain and Perimeter Access Control (PAC) Safety Light Curtains work in the same way. The only real difference between PAC & POC is the usage of situations.

Types of Safety Light Curtains:

Whenever you are selecting a Safety Light Curtain, Commonly this word we will hear is “Which Type of  Safety Light Curtain, Is it Type 2 or Type 4?”

Now you are going to get an idea about What is the difference between Type 2 & Type 4 Safety Light Curtain.

In Simple, Here I Explain

Type 4: When the level of risk is higher, we need to use much higher safety standards, that is Type 4 safety Light Curtains. It will detect and immediately send a signal to shut down a machine (Safety function is continuously monitored) which means a Shorter response time. It is more expensive because it’s offering more features. Type 4 Safety Light Curtains are used almost exclusively as a Primary Safety Component. It’s available for finger, hand, and body detection.

Then coming to the Type 2

Type 2: Type 2 Safety Light Curtains, on the other hand, is a simple optical safety device. This type is designed for situations where the level of risk is lower. Type 2 has less safety features so we can’t use it in high-risk areas. Sometimes this Type-2 Safety Light Curtain won’t detect immediately, which means the Safety function is monitored periodically and response time is long. So if you use this Type 2 for critical applications it’s very dangerous. It is cheaper than Type 4 Safety Light Curtains because it will offer less features. It will be used sometimes for secondary protection safety components. It’s available for hand and body detection.

Which Type of Light Curtain Is Right for Your Machine:

There are a lot of factors that will play when deciding on safety light curtain types. You have to know what level of protection you’re looking for: Point of Operation Control (POC) Safety Light Curtain and Perimeter Access Control (PAC) Safety Light Curtains. And you have to know what risk level your machine is.

The risk level is one of the most important things when you are choosing a Safety Light Curtain type. And some of the question we need to ask to choose the type of light curtain those are How often are people exposed to this machine, How often is an injury to occur, How severe is that potential injury etc.,

Not every application will require a Type 4 device. Even though type 2 devices are a lesser option, for certain machines, they are all that is required. Alternatively, some machines only require type 4 devices as the added level of protection is required for the application.

What is the Operating Range?

The Operating Range is nothing but the distance between the Emitter and Receiver. Some of the models have Fixed distance, Some models having selectable range or Auto-adjusting. Based on your application correctly we need to check then only it will perfectly fit your application.

Some of the common mistakes people make when choosing a Safety Light Curtain is they will choose a long-range device for short-distance applications, reflections off nearby surfaces may make the installation unsafe. On the other hand, a long-range device may be required for protecting large areas which require a high beam.

What is Protective Height?

The height of a Safety Light Curtain must be chosen based on the access to the hazard. 

For example, if a light curtain is protecting against “point protection” then the light curtain must cover the whole aperture. However, if the Safety product is for access protection then different heights can be used based on the number of beams required and the height from the floor plus possible reach over.

What is Beam Gap?

In the Safety Light Curtain, Emitter consists of Light Emitting Diodes (LED’s), It will emit the light, this light we can call it is a Beam. The gap or distance between the two beams is nothing Beam gap. 

Why beam gap is important? If your application is Finger protection. If you select Beam Gap is high then it won’t suitable for your finger protection application. Just keep in mind.

What is the Interlocking Function?

In Simple, The interlock function sets an interlock under specific conditions. An interlock is when the machine operation is stopped and, for Safety Light Curtains, control outputs are turned OFF.

Start/Restart Interlock: The Safety Sensor is interlocked when the power is turned ON and the Sensor beam is interrupted.

Start Interlock: The Safety Sensor is interlocked only after the power is turned ON.

Restart Interlock: The Safety Sensor is interlocked only when the Sensor beam is interrupted.

What is the Muting Function?

In Simple, The Muting function is the automatic cut-out of the light curtain protective function in relation to the machine cycle. Muting can only occur in a safety condition.

In the Same applications, we need to mute some Beams (LED Beams). Suppose one converse application we are using Protection height is 700mm, the number of beams is 34. My requirement is sometimes / frequently Boxes need to cross Light Curtain beams nearly 5 beams. If breams are interrupted automatically conveyor is going to stop. But Here Box passing through the Light curtain bottom 5 beams is an application.  So we can mute that. That means if any box passes through those selected 5 beams it’s not going to give a signal to the controller to stop the conveyor. 

The Muting function is available on both Type 2 and Type 4 safety light curtains. Based on our application we can use the muting function.

What is the Resolution? 

In the field, we can call it with different names like Sensing capability, minimum object sensitivity, or detection capability – which is the ability of an optical system to reliably detect an object anywhere within the sensing field.

This ensures an object of that size cross-section or larger will always be detected and issued a stop command. Safety light screens typically are grouped based on sensing capability and include high-resolution, medium-resolution, and low-resolution.

Higher-resolution light curtains are usually more expensive compare to lower resolutions, but switching to a lower resolution means that the distance between the safety light curtain and the hazard needs to be increased which may be impractical or not possible on the factory floor.

What is the PNP/NPN Selection?

In Sensors generally, we will discuss Outputs are PNP or NPN (If it’s 3 wire) Safety Light Curtain also same like Sensors (Same Like Photoelectric Sensors) but these Safety Sensors are manufacturing with safety standards. 

Then Coming to our PNP/NPN Selection, mostly it will depend on the controller that means Safety Light Curtain won’t stop the machine it will send a signal to Controller Controller will send a signal to the Motor than the machine needs to stop or it will break the power supply to the machine. So what I am going to say here is based on the Controller you need to choose Safety Light Curtain Output also. 

What is the Cable Type & Connector Type?

Cable Type: Safety Light Curtain includes/ consists of wire. That means the bottom of the Safety Light Curtain wire will come (Pre-wire). Directly we need to install it into the controller. Whenever you want to replace first you need to remove the wiring in the controller and then need to remove mountings again need to replace them with a new one. Again when you are doing wiring be careful.

Connector Type: The bottom of the Safety Light Curtain consists of a connector (Male Pin). When we are doing installation we should have a separate Cable(One Edge is Cable wire, Other Edge is Connector-Female Pin). One of the most plus points is If the safety Light Curtain is not working and you want to replace it with a new one Just remove the connector (Male-Female) Just Replace New Safety Light Curtain and add connectors (Male-Female). It is an Easy Maintenance.

Step 1: Check Certification

In Safety products, Certifications are the most important thing. When you are selecting or finalizing the brand for the Safety component we need to know those brands have Safety Certifications or not. Sometimes some people using Area Sensors instead of Safety Light Curtain. It’s a really bad thing and very dangerous. 

Some of the common certifications are ISO 13849-1, IEC 62061 and IEC 61508 etc., So before deciding brand you must check certification. You can check those details on their website or call them and ask them what are certification your safety components having.

Safety Light Curtain Certifications

Step 2: Understand about Machine Installed Environment

A most common mistake when you are selecting a safety Light Curtain is they are not thinking about where they are going to install like what is the Temperature, excess moisture, and other aspects that can easily damage equipment. Light curtains need to be resistant to these pressures.

Suppose your machine is High Temperature or has excess moisture and you are going to buy your new Safety Light Curtain in Leuze Brand. 

First, you need to know if the Leuze brand series is suitable for a High-Temperature workplace or high moisture place. 

If you check their website briefly they are going to mention Advanced features, So briefly we need to observe all the series. If 3-4 models (More models) offer this feature Just keep those 3-4 models in note/paper. Later we will finalize one Series and one model.

Step 5: What Detection Capability Does It Have? (Resolution)

The resolution or detection capability of a light curtain refers to the amount of separation between its laser beams. There are many different resolution options. For example, a 14mm resolution is appropriate for finger detection and is used when the curtain is placed very close to the source of hazardous motion. Hand detection is achieved with a 25-30mm resolution.

Step 8: Safety Light Curtain Output (PNP/NPN)

As I explained in the previous chapter Safety Light Curtain won’t stop the machine directly. Safety Light Curtain will send a signal to the Controller and the Controller will give the command to motors/ power supply. it will break the power supply to the machine. 

So based on the controller you should select PNP or NPN output for your application.

Step 9: Connection Type

This step is not that much important. But don’t ignore it. Prewire or Connector type which one is the best choice for you just think over it and decide it.

Prewire type is somewhat economical and Connector type Cable separately we need to purchase it somewhat price is high. (Sometimes based on Brands wise Prices are wise versa).
